Hinshaw partner Bessie Daschbach discussed the recent wave of pushback against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) and the outlook for ESG in a blog post published by the American College of Environmental Lawyers (ACOEL).
Daschbach cited pushback against ESG at both the state and federal levels, stating that, to date, 18 states have proposed or adopted anti-ESG legislation. She added that at least one House bill aimed at ESG has also come to the fore—H.R. 9543, titled the "ESG Rule Prevention Act."
Daschbach noted that despite the swelling anti-ESG wave, proponents of ESG remain committed and are doubling down on the business case for ESG. "[H]eadlines for the coming year will be marked by news covering the trajectory of anti-ESG developments. But, given the unimpeded pace of ESG developments over the last year even amidst the wave of these anti-ESG developments, together with the stated (and re-stated) business case for ESG, it is fair to assume ESG is not going away," she stated.
"ESG: What Is The Outlook?" was published by the American College of Environmental Lawyers on January 11, 2023.
